MUMBAI: It is a knowledgeable input to know our favourite celebrity life before they became a Bollywood star. Some actors did not become stars overnight but behind their stardom is a great struggle story. Few among many Bollywood actors used to work for normal jobs. This was before they achieved great fame in the film industry. For instance, Sacred Games fame Nawazuddin Siddiqui used to work as a watchman in his struggling life prior to becoming a star, Gully Boy actor Ranveer Singh used to work as a copywriter for a famous ad agency.

Born stars vaguely mean that the talent for acting has been running in their genes since the very start of their life! There are many big names in the world of the entertainment industry today, who took up acting later in their lives, after giving other jobs a chance, then they shifted to be a part of Bollywood.

While Haseen Dillruba actor Harshvardhan Rane left his hometown at the age of 16 and did odd jobs, Nawazuddin Siddiqui had worked as a watchman before making it big in Bollywood. Check out the stories below,

Amitabh Bachchan

image.png

The Big B of Bollywood is now known as a legend in Bollywood, not many know that Big B’s first-ever job was in a coal mine which was located in Kolkata where he worked for about 7-8 years! He later started working as a business executive before turning to theatres and showing his acting skills.

Nawazuddin Siddiqui

image.png

Success did not come easily to Nawazuddin. Siddiqui had to struggle very hard to set a benchmark in the Bollywood industry. During his days of struggle, the actor used to work as a watchman before making a name for himself in the film industry.

Harshvardhan Rane

Rane is spotted in his recently-released film Haseen Dillruba, Harshvardhan had shared in several interviews that he ran away from his hometown when he was aged 16 and took up odd jobs such as re-designing old furniture, working as a delivery boy and had even delivered a helmet to John Abraham once! The actor has now achieved a fame name in Bollywood.

Ranveer Singh

image.png

Ranveer Singh has gained huge popularity in the Bollywood industry. His name flashes in the A-listers in the film industry. Ranveer is currently ‘the big thing’ in the film industry but once, used to work as a copywriter at a popular ad agency.

Boman Irani

image.png
Boman Irani is an inspiration for many. This is for those who aren’t afraid of starting something new in life, irrespective of one’s age. Age cannot be a barrier at all, is what is proved by Boman Irani. Before making it big in the film industry, the actor once used to wait tables at the Taj Mahal Palace in Mumbai.
